WebIN738LC is a cast nickel-base superalloy developed for applications requiring high strength at elevated temperatures. Its balanced composition provides a good combination of tensile and creep-rupture properties as a result of gamma prime precipitate strengthening enhanced by solid solution and grain-boundary strengthening. images of modern india https://plumsebastian.com

WebThe IN738 LC alloy hardness (unused blade) is about 400 HV, while comparing this with the same specified in Table 3 it shows that the used blade level of hardness has been decreased for 10 to 15%, the reason of which depends on the γ’ particles sizes increase and also their decreased volume fraction during the service.
